Chimney Repairs Hove East Sussex (BN3): It's easy to forget about the chimney when tending to home maintenance, but ignoring it can set the stage for complications later on. A chimney is only as strong as its brickwork and mortar, so when cracks, gaps, and loose pots appear, they need dealing with fast. Homeowners in Hove need to be proactive when it comes to chimney maintenance to avoid the risk of collapse or water damage through hidden gaps.
After years of putting up with Britain's famous mix of rain, wind, and cold snaps, chimneys don't stay in perfect condition forever. Rain, wind, and frost can all play a part in weakening your chimney's structure, which can cause small cracks to escalate into bigger problems. Regular chimney maintenance stops minor issues from escalating into big, costly jobs.

If you sense a smoky odour or if your chimney isn't functioning as it should, it might be wise to think about what could be going wrong. A blocked flue, a liner that's seen better days, or a deteriorating chimney stack can all hamper the effectiveness of your fireplace. A pro will know exactly what to look for when checking your chimney, reducing the risk of fires and carbon monoxide poisoning.
A chimney that isn't properly sealed can be a real pain, and many homeowners in Hove have dealt with just that. To prevent damp patches and structural damage, it's essential to ensure the flashing around the base of your chimney is in good condition and the seals are intact. Sorting out these issues promptly can help you sidestep expensive repairs later, plus it ensures a warm and dry home environment.
Repointing often appears on the list of chimney repairs because it's a commonly required job, and there are good reasons for that choice. As the years pass, the mortar holding the bricks together can start to deteriorate, leaving behind gaps that weaken the structure. Upgrading to new, weather-resistant pointing instead of that old mortar does wonders for your chimney, making it sturdier while keeping moisture out.

If the chimney stack's in rough shape, you could be heading toward a partial or full rebuild to get it sorted once and for all. The last thing you need in a storm is a weakened chimney coming apart - loose bricks and shifting stacks can make it a real hazard. When experienced pros handle the rebuild, they restore the chimney's safety and functionality, making sure it stays sturdy for years ahead.
With regard to fireplace safety, chimney liners do a lot of the heavy lifting by protecting your flue and improving efficiency. With a damaged chimney liner, there's a real chance heat will escape and harmful gases will make their way indoors. When you replace a damaged or ageing liner, you're not just boosting chimney performance - you're also cutting back on fire risks.
A chimney pot that's cracked or missing isn't merely an unpleasant sight; it can cause ventilation issues, let rain into your flue, and even attract birds looking to nest in the wrong spot. Sorting out a broken pot is a simple matter for a pro, who will make sure it's properly fitted and the right size for your chimney. When you replace it properly, your chimney stays safe, works well, and looks the way it should.
When birds or debris invade an open chimney, it's often the beginning of a string of unwanted issues. A chimney with a cowl or cap keeps out nesting birds and other critters while making sure smoke can still leave. You can count on this simple trick to keep your flue clear and your home in Hove safe and sound.
Don't even consider working on a chimney without a sturdy ladder; guesswork isn't a safe approach at all. For safe chimney repairs, access platforms are a must; they offer a stable environment that helps professionals avoid accidents. To make sure everything's done properly and safely from start to finish, it's vital to have the right platform for tasks like fixing flashing, repointing brickwork, or changing a chimney pot.

Sure, it might be tempting to jump onto the roof and do some chimney repairs yourself to save a few pounds, but this job is fraught with danger and calls for the right tools and skills. Doing a half-hearted job on repairs can just make matters worse, leading to leaks, structural issues, or even dangerous things like carbon monoxide leaks. Employing a professional means you're getting someone who understands the details and knows how to fix them efficiently, which saves you hassle, stress, and possibly larger bills down the road.
Getting the right team in for chimney repairs means you can rest easy knowing it's been done properly. A practised professional will evaluate what damage is present, offer options, and complete repairs using superior materials tailored to the job. When it comes to small fixes or complete restorations, experienced hands can really change the outcome. In Hove, there are plenty of services that can help you along the way.
It's simple: regular chimney maintenance saves you money and keeps your home safe, so it's a no-brainer. Booking an annual inspection and dealing with minor repairs at an early stage can help you to avoid major structural issues later on. A quick look at your chimney now can help you steer clear of stress later.
